# 🌍 World Environment Day 🌱 Happy **World Environment Day**! While this might not be *completely* obscure since the UN established it, most people don't know much about it beyond the name, so let me take you on a deep dive into this eco-celebration! ## The Origins World Environment Day was established by the United Nations General Assembly in 1972 (making it over 50 years old now!). It emerged from the Stockholm Conference on the Human Environment, which was basically humanity's first big "uh oh, we should probably talk about this whole planet thing" moment. ## Why June 5th? June 5th was chosen because it was the opening day of that historic Stockholm Conference. The first celebration happened in 1973 under the theme "Only One Earth" – which, let's be honest, still hits hard today. ## The Fun Traditions Each year features a different **host country** and **theme**. Countries go absolutely wild with celebrations: - **Tree-planting marathons** where communities compete to plant the most trees - **Eco-fashion shows** featuring clothing made entirely from recycled materials - **Plastic-free challenges** where entire cities try to go 24 hours without single-use plastics - **Beach clean-up competitions** (surprisingly competitive!) ## The Quirky Side Some countries have developed delightfully weird traditions: - In parts of India, people give plants as gifts instead of flowers - Some Japanese communities hold "insect hotels" building contests - Kenyan schoolchildren often perform elaborate environmental-themed plays So today, maybe hug a tree, pick up some litter, or just appreciate that we live on a pretty spectacular rock floating through space! 🌎✨
